Foros del Web

Foros del Web (http://www.forosdelweb.com/)
-   ASP Clásico (http://www.forosdelweb.com/f15/)
-   -   Insertar Numero En Columna (http://www.forosdelweb.com/f15/insertar-numero-columna-582697/)

darkmcloud 04/05/2008 01:46

Insertar Numero En Columna
 
Buenas amigos de foros del web....mi consulta es la siguiente :
¿como puedo agregarle un numero de columna cuando muestro una tabla en asp ??

me explico : si tengo 10 registros y los muestro hacia abajo, la idea mia es que a la primera fila aparezca un numero "1" y y asi sucesivamente hasta que en la ultima aparezca un numero "10" en una columna llamada Nº .....

De antemano muchas gracias

Myakire 05/05/2008 07:42

Re: Insertar Numero En Columna
 
Supongo muestras los n registros mediante un ciclo, simplemente incrementa una variable en ese ciclo y vela imprimiendo junto con los datos del registro

darkmcloud 05/05/2008 11:34

Re: Insertar Numero En Columna
 
disculpa la ignorancia, pero como hago ese ciclo ???
este es el codigo de mis tabla :

Código:


  <% set Cnn=Server.CreateObject("ADODB.Connection")
        set rs=Server.CreateObject("ADODB.Recordset")
        Cnn.Open Session("cnx")
       
        strSQl="select  *, DATEDIFF (minute, time_accion, getdate()) as difes from tblusuarios where DATEDIFF (minute, time_accion, getdate()) < 56982299 and DATEDIFF (DAY, fecha_accion, getdate()) = 0 and estado='online' "
set rs = Cnn.Execute(strSQL)
cnn.Execute(strSQL)
       
        If not rs.EOF then

%>
   
        </p>
                  <TABLE WIDTH=294 BORDER=1 align="center"  CELLSPACING="1">
                    <tr>
  <td width="76"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Usuario</font></strong></div></td>
  <td width="56"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Hora</font></strong></div></td>
  <td width="55"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Ip</font></strong></div></td>
    <td width="99"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Visitando</font></strong></div></td>

  </tr>
          <%do while not rs.EOF%>
 
        <tr>
  <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("idusuario")%></small></font></div></td>
  <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("time_accion")%></small></font></div></td>
  <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("ip")%></small></font></div></td>
    <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("visitando")%></small></font></div></td>

<%rs.Movenext%>
 
</tr>
  <%loop

end if

rs.Close

set rs = nothing

Cnn.Close

set Cnn = nothing
%>


JuanRAPerez 05/05/2008 11:44

Re: Insertar Numero En Columna
 
Myakire dijo:

<tr>
<td width="76"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">No.</font></strong></div></td>
<td width="76"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Usuario</font></strong></div></td>
<td width="56"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Hora</font></strong></div></td>
<td width="55"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Ip</font></strong></div></td>
<td width="99"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Visitando</font></strong></div></td>

</tr>
<%Contador = 0%>
<%do while not rs.EOF%>
<%Contador = Contador + 1%>

<tr>
<td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=Contador%></small></font></div></td>

<td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("idusuario")%></small></font></div></td>
<td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("time_accion")%></small></font></div></td>
<td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("ip")%></small></font></div></td>
<td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("visitando")%></small></font></div></td>

<%rs.Movenext%>

</tr>


claro esta si lo que quieres es colocar un numero correlativo a la par de el id de usuario


suerte

Myakire 05/05/2008 11:44

Re: Insertar Numero En Columna
 
Solo agrega estas líneas:
Código:

<TABLE WIDTH=294 BORDER=1 align="center"  CELLSPACING="1">
                    <tr>
  <td width="10" bgcolor="#F0F0F0"> ID</td>

  <td width="76" bgcolor="#F0F0F0"> <div align="center"><strong><font
face="Verdana, Arial, Helvetica, sans-serif">Usuario</font></strong></div></td>
  <td width="56"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Hora</font></strong></div></td>
  <td width="55"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Ip</font></strong></div></td>
    <td width="99" bgcolor="#F0F0F0"> <div align="center"><strong><font face="Verdana, Arial, Helvetica, sans-serif">Visitando</font></strong></div></td>

  </tr>
          <%Cnt=1
              do while not rs.EOF%>
 
        <tr>
      <td><%=Cnt%></td>
  <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("idusuario")%></small></font></div></td>
  <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("time_accion")%></small></font></div></td>
  <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("ip")%></small></font></div></td>
    <td><div align="center"><font size="2" face="Verdana, Arial, Helvetica, sans-serif"><small><%=RS.Fields("visitando")%></small></font></div></td>

<%rs.Movenext
        Cnt = Cnt + 1
%>
 
</tr>
  <%loop


Myakire 05/05/2008 11:46

Re: Insertar Numero En Columna
 
Diablos!

Me ganaste por 14 segundos JuanRAPerez (:adios:), :-D

darkmcloud 05/05/2008 11:51

Re: Insertar Numero En Columna
 
muchas gracias por sus respuestas amigos....se pasaron !!! hasta pronto !!!

GRACIAS TOTALES !!!

JuanRAPerez 05/05/2008 12:24

Re: Insertar Numero En Columna
 
Cita:

Iniciado por Myakire (Mensaje 2391054)
Diablos!

Me ganaste por 14 segundos JuanRAPerez (:adios:), :-D


jejejej lo siento - jijiij -


La zona horaria es GMT -6. Ahora son las 23:32.

Desarrollado por vBulletin® Versión 3.8.7
Derechos de Autor ©2000 - 2026, Jelsoft Enterprises Ltd.